'It is a dream to work with Sudeep'

Actor, director and scriptwriter Rakshit Shetty dons multiple roles with ease and finesse. The young man’s acting prowess, ability to envisage things and technical knowledge of filmmaking have already brought him in the forefront of Sandalwood's promising bunch.

Rakshit is currently working on a script that has Sudeep in the lead role. “I am still working on the script and it will take a while before I am done with it. The current script requires a lot of research because I’ve made a lot of references to the World War I in the movie,” shares Rakshit. “The challenge is to blend reality with fiction,” he adds.  This is the first time that Rakshit and Sudeep are working together and Rakshit says that he couldn’t be happier. “It’s been a dream to work with Sudeep. He’s a brilliant actor and a wonderful director. It is definitely going to be an enriching experience because he is someone who is also thorough with the technical side of filmmaking,” observes Rakshit.

As an actor and director, Rakshit wants to experiment with as many subjects as possible. Ask him about his preferred genre of films and he points out that he has acted in just about every genre. “It’s quite challenging to play negative characters, it tests your acting skills. But I would like to dip my fingers in as many different themes and genres as possible,” he says.

He is currently working on ‘Ricky’, which is a romantic-action film and has agreed to work on ‘Godhi Banna Sadharana MyKattu’ that explores the relationship between a father and son. His third project, ‘Avane Sriman Narayana’ is a comedy film. “I have an interesting pool of projects and each one promises to be a different experience,” he says.   

The one thing that Rakshit has learnt from the business of acting is, “You have to believe and repose faith in yourself as an actor. There’s always a constant challenge to prove yourself in a very competitive atmosphere.”
